   Sec. 2. Murder is not bailable if the state proves by a preponderance of the evidence that the proof is evident or the presumption strong. In all other cases, offenses are bailable.

As added by Acts 1981, P.L.298, SEC.2. Amended by P.L.41-2018, SEC.1.
